      Farm Boy again.  Making the valves.  3/8 dia valve head with 1/8″ dia x 1.4″ long stem in stainless.

      Lathe:- Boxford 9″ dia

      I have some stainless which turns OK but trying to turn the long stem as the workpiece flexes is giving unacceptable run out.  Do you step turn say 1/2″ to diameter plus 0.001″ then turn the next 1/2″ until required length, then burnish with emery cloth?

      I think 1/8″ is too small for travelling steady.

      Ideas please.

        I just use a BS 0 ctr drill and put a very small hole in the end so I can turn valve stems between ctrs. Never had a problem with them not sealing. Use 303 stainless

          In the past I’ve drilled a small bushing held in my tailstock drill chuck to the materials diameter and used that to support the material…a form of between centres turning.  I also have a tool-holder with a ‘guide’ that can be drilled to the (un-machined) diameter of the piece and where the cut happens as the metal is fed through. Can’t recall ever using it though. Seemed useful when I purchased it!  🙂
